Baked Strawberry Cake Donuts Recipe
Introduction
These baked strawberry cake donuts are a delightful way to enjoy the fresh flavors of summer in a soft, tender treat. Lightly sweetened and naturally fruity, they’re perfect for breakfast, snacks, or any time you want a bit of homemade joy. Baking instead of frying makes them a lighter option without sacrificing flavor.

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on Unsalted Butter
- ¾ cup Sugar
- 1 Egg
- ¾ teaspoon Vanilla Extract
- ½ cup Buttermilk
- ¾ cup Cake Flour
- ¾ cup All-Purpose Flour
- ½ teaspoon Baking Soda
- 1 teaspoon Baking Powder
- ¼ teaspoon Salt
- 12-15 Strawberries (about 1 cup pureed)
Instructions
- Step 1: Puree the ripe strawberries in a food processor until smooth and set aside.
- Step 2: In a mixing bowl, cream together the butter, sugar, and egg until the mixture is light and airy.
- Step 3: Stir in the vanilla extract, buttermilk, and strawberry puree until well combined.
- Step 4: In a separate bowl, sift together the cake flour, all-purpose fl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t.
- Step 5: Gently f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ture just until combined, being careful not to overmix.
- Step 6: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and grease your donut pans thoroughly.
- Step 7: Pipe or spoon the batter into each donut cavity, filling them evenly.
- Step 8: Bake for 7-8 minutes, or until the donuts spring back when lightly touched.
- Step 9: Allow the donuts to cool slightly before removing from the pan. Serve plain or with a glaze or powdered sugar if desired.
Tips & Variations
- For a stronger strawberry flavor, fold in small chopped strawberries into the batter before baking.
- Use Greek yogurt instead of buttermilk for a different tang and tenderness.
- Experiment with a simple glaze made of powdered sugar and lemon juice for added brightness.
- If you don’t have donut pans, use a muffin pan and reduce baking time slightly.
Storage
Store baked strawberry donuts in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. For longer storage, keep them in the refrigerator for up to 5 days or freeze for up to 1 month. Reheat gently in a microwave or oven to restore softness.

FAQs
Can I use frozen strawberries for the puree?
Yes, you can use frozen strawberries. Thaw them completely and drain excess liquid before pureeing to avoid thinning the batter too much.
Are these donuts suitable for frying instead of baking?
This recipe is designed for baking, which keeps the donuts light and tender. Frying might alter their texture and cooking time, so if you prefer fried donuts, using a traditional donut recipe is recommended.
